def step_with_adjustments(
input: TensorMapping,
next_step_input_data: TensorMapping,
network_calls: Callable[[TensorDict], TensorDict],
normalizer: StandardNormalizer,
corrector: CorrectorABC | None,
ocean: Ocean | None,
residual_prediction: bool,
prognostic_names: list[str],
prescribed_prognostic_names: list[str] | None = None,
global_mean_removal: GlobalMeanRemoval | None = None,
data_mask: TensorMapping | None = None,
stepper_state: StepperState | None = None,
) -> tuple[TensorDict, StepperState | None]:
"""
Step the model forward one timestep given input data.
Args:
input: Mapping from variable name to tensor of shape
[n_batch, n_lat, n_lon] containing denormalized data from the
initial timestep. In practice this contains the ML inputs.
next_step_input_data: Mapping from variable name to tensor of shape
[n_batch, n_lat, n_lon] containing denormalized data from
the output timestep. In practice this contains the necessary data
at the output timestep for the ocean model and corrector.
network_calls: Callable[[TensorMapping], TensorDict] that takes a
normalized input and returns a normalized output.
normalizer: The normalizer to use.
corrector: The corrector to use at the end of each step.
ocean: The ocean model to use.
residual_prediction: Whether to use residual prediction.
prognostic_names: Names of prognostic variables.
prescribed_prognostic_names: Prognostic names to overwrite from
next_step_input_data after the ocean step (e.g. for inference).
global_mean_removal: Optional transform that removes per-sample
global means before normalization and restores them after
denormalization. When provided, ``forward_transform`` is called
before the normalizer and ``inverse_transform`` after
denormalization but before the corrector/ocean/prescribed steps,
so those adjustments operate in physical space.
data_mask: Per-variable boolean masks passed to
``global_mean_removal.forward_transform``.
stepper_state: Per-sample state carried across step calls. The
corrector's slice (``stepper_state.corrector_state``) is passed to
the corrector and any updates are written back into a returned
``StepperState``. Pass-through unchanged when no corrector is set.
Returns:
A tuple ``(output, stepper_state)`` where ``output`` is the
denormalized data at the next time step.
"""
if prescribed_prognostic_names is None:
prescribed_prognostic_names = []
if global_mean_removal is not None:
network_input: TensorMapping = global_mean_removal.forward_transform(
input, data_mask
)
else:
network_input = input
input_norm = normalizer.normalize(network_input)
output_norm = network_calls(input_norm)
if residual_prediction:
output_norm = add_names(input_norm, output_norm, prognostic_names)
output = normalizer.denormalize(output_norm)
if global_mean_removal is not None:
output = global_mean_removal.inverse_transform(output)
if corrector is not None:
corrector_state: CorrectorState | None = (
stepper_state.corrector_state if stepper_state is not None else None
)
output, corrector_state = corrector(
input, output, next_step_input_data, corrector_state
)
if corrector_state is not None:
stepper_state = StepperState(corrector_state=corrector_state)
if ocean is not None:
output = ocean(input, output, next_step_input_data)
for name in prescribed_prognostic_names:
if name in next_step_input_data:
output = {**output, name: next_step_input_data[name]}
else:
raise ValueError(
f"prescribed_prognostic_name '{name}' not in next_step_input_data"
)
return output, stepper_state
